Refrigerators with a mini-bar door are perfect for those who do not want to open their entire fridge to get to drinks. These are ideal for guest houses, dorms and basements, as they permit you to have a refreshing beverage without opening the main door of the fridge.

Our American style fridge freezers that come with water dispenser and ice are available in both non-plumbed and plumbed options. Models with plumbed connections are connected directly to the household water supply and allow you to have fresh, chilled water on hand immediately. Non-plumbed models come with water tanks in varying sizes that you'll need to manually refill from time to time.

Energy efficiency

Fridge freezers are on all day and use up lots of energy. A fridge with an energy-efficient rating will aid in saving on electricity bills and cut carbon emissions as well.

Find refrigerators that are marked A-G according to the new energy label. The rating now gives you more information than the power consumption. It informs you how much energy the appliance consumes annually (kWh) as well as the type of insulation it has, whether or not it's integrated into cabinetry and what the noise level is.
